#711116 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#711116 is composed of 44.3% red, 6.7%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85% magenta, 80.5%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 356.9 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 25.5%. #711116 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2222c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

#711116 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#711116 has RGB values of R:113, G:17,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.81,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7409942.

Shades and Tints of #711116
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0202 is the darkest color, while #fef9f9 is the lightest one.
